Transaction 90d4255931087ded27e83f5ca571afecf8929ff40bc62be04298082763baa56b
1 Input
1 Output
-
90d4255931087ded27e83f5ca571afecf8929ff40bc62be04298082763baa56b:0
- value
- 19085552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a07ea1f4bf16f4e78734c193baa6ee30b491bbd OP_EQUAL
- address
- 3QV4LQvQ7iDo4ZgvUn7FykPRdzDX5iYuiq